Ayesha born to a Gujrati father and a half British and half Maharashtrian mother. She has been in front of the camera since the tender age of 4. Ayesha married with Farhan Azmi on March 2009

Initially she did advertisements, and later at the age of fifteen she appeared in Phalguni Pathak’s melodious song "Meri Chunar Udd Udd Jaye"

Another big hit ‘Shake it daddy’ opened the Bollywood doors for her and with her very first movie Tarzaan The Wonder Car in 2004, she made her presence felt with an outstanding performance. Ayesha won the best debut female at Filmfare for this movie.

In 2006, she was amongst the Top Ten on the listing of India's 50 Most Desirable Women Alive, a poll conducted by Zoom, an Indian TV channel.

Aishwarya Rai Biography

Date of Birth - 1 November 1973, Mangalore, Karnataka, India 
Birth Name - Aishwarya Krishnaraj Rai
Nickname - Aish, Gullu

Height - 5' 7" (1.70 m)
Mini Biography -
Aishwarya is one of Bollywood's preeminent leading lady. This Indian darling had introduced herself on the world stage and striking beauty, poise and commanding intelligence won the Miss World crown in 1994. India's top Bollywood directors were soon lining up to work with Ash. This former architecture major soon became one of India's most famous models landing a prestigious Pepsi campaign and appearing in Vogue Magazine. Her film "Debut" in Mani Rathnam's 'Iruvar' (1997) received critical acclaim and her performance in Aur Paar Ho Gaya' (1997) directed by Rahul Rawail garnered her the Best Female Debutante Award. In 2000 she was awarded Best Actress by Filmfare and Zee Cine for her work in Sanjay Leela Bhansali's "Hum Dil De Chuke Sanam", in that same year, nominated for Best Supporting Actress for her special appearance in Aditya Chopra's Mohabbatein (2000). In 2001 Aish was nominated for Filmfare's Best Actress Award for Satish Kaushik's "Hamara Dil Aapke Paas Hai".

Aish's star continued to rise in 2002 working again with Sajay Leela Bhansali in 'Devdas'. 'Devdas' is the most ambitious and most successful film in Bollywood history. It became the first Bollywood picture to ever receive a special screening at this year's Cannes Film Festival and broke box-office records in India and the United States.

2003 brought even more exciting opportunities. Ash became the first Indian actor to be a member of the jury at the Cannes Film Festival. She is also the latest member of the elite L'Oreal Dream Team, joining beauties Catherine Deneuve & Andie MacDowell as their international ambassador. She graced the covers of India Today and the prestigious TIME Magazine. Time Magazine has also listed her on their list of the "100 Most Influential People in the World Today". She has graced numerous covers worldwide including USA, UK, China, Russia, Israel, United Emerites, Italy, Spain and France. Ash was also listed on Rolling Stone Magazine's annual "Hot List", Hello Magazine's Most Attractive Women in the World", Stuff Magazine, FHM magazine, V-Life from Variety Magazine, GQ Magazine, New York Times Magazine, Harper's & Queen and countless others.

2004 saw Aishwarya take on the leading role in her first English language film for Gurinder Chadha in "Bride & Prejudice". She also became the first Indian female to be immortalized in wax at the world famous Madame Tussaud's wax museum in London.
